Hypertension – more commonly known as high blood pressure – affects about 25% of the American adult population. Not surprisingly, hypertension is among the most common medical conditions in the United States and worldwide. Here's the thing: high blood pressure isn't just bad for your heart. In fact, it's one of the major contributing factors that cause erectile dysfunction (ED). That said, it's important to understand hypertension and the role it may play on your erectile and sexual performance. After all, erections are mainly a product of healthy blood circulation and blood flow.
